April 25, 2016 Filing 3 Filed order (WILLIAM A. FLETCHER and RICHARD A. PAEZ) The request for a certificate of appealability is granted with respect to the following issues: (1) whether pretrial or trial counsel provided ineffective assistance in (a) failing to present evidence of appellants alleged mental incapacity during the guilt phase of the trial to negate the mens rea for first degree murder, (b) mishandling pretrial and competency hearings and failing to adequately investigate, (c) failing to adequately prepare for the trials sanity phase or to raise stronger arguments, (d) failing to provide a detailed opening statement, or (e) failing to provide records from all of appellants psychiatric hospitalizations to the experts in the sanity phase; (2) whether there was insufficient evidence to support the jurys finding that appellant was legally sane at the time of the offenses, including whether this claim is cognizable on federal habeas review; and (3) whether there was cumulative error. See 28 U.S.C. 2253(c)(3); see also 9th Cir. R. 22-1(e). The opening brief is due August 9, 2016; the answering brief is due September 8, 2016; the optional reply brief is due within 14 days after service of the answering brief.
